    I would rate this salon 10 stars if I could! I went on my birthday for a haircut with Lawrence, and wow! Just wow! I left feeling amazing! He knew exactly what to do with my hair once I went over my pain points -- I'd recently cut my own bangs and was struggling to style them as they grew out. He immediately spotted that they needed to be blended with the rest of my hair and he went a step further to teach me to style them when he did my blowout. Its been a week now and I just tried his technique at home and it worked!!! Thank you, Lawrence! He was a joy to visit and chat with as well! I will be back (regularly) for sure. It's also worth noting the salon aesthetic is absolutely gorgeous, definitely insta-worthy! Same with their sister boutique down the road.

    As a hairstylist of 27 years, so I knew exactly what I was getting into when I decided to make a rather dramatic change to my hair. My natural hair color is dark brown with about 75% grey, mostly in the front. I was very clear in that booking request that I needed a master stylist who was familiar with complex processes, as I knew to achieve what I wanted would take 3 to 4 visits . I was also prepared to pay up to $3000. At the consultation I showed her pictures of what I wanted, for those not familiar, It's called a color smudge. I told her that I expected the first visit to be an all over bleach, and that I knew I would not "like" how it looked , because the only level to reach after years of color, would likely be an orange yellow. She assured me she was able to achieve the look I was looking for, so we went to the receptionist and scheduled three appointments, that were approximately five days apart from each other. Ideally giving my hair a break before doing the next process. At the first visit, the stylist began foiling my entire head, and I reminded her of the plan that we talked about and how foiling would be exceptionally difficult for three more processes. She assured me she knew what she was doing, and had everything under control. Needless to say, I did not leave with the progress that I expected on the first visit. While hesitant, I decided to go back for the second process, mainly because it was too late to try to book an appointment elsewhere, and I could not spend an undetermined amount of time with my hair looking like this. During the second visit, she proceeded to foil my hair, a second time, this time only in the front , she also foiled from center part down, and again as she started, I asked her why she wasn't foiling front to back to avoid that runway strip... She said this is just how I do it and I'm more comfortable doing what I know. While the bleach was processing, she brought out a very, very small bowl of color and ask what I thought of. I told her it looked like bubblegum... I wanted sophisticated somewhere between magenta and mahogany. I also advised that I knew it was not nearly enough quantity to fully saturate the back of my head, and do the very heavy low lights that were expected in the front. Her only answer was that's all we have. Now yes, logically I should have gotten up and left, but when you are five days away from your birthday, and you don't wanna show up to dinner with orange hair... You hope for the best you hope that another stylist or a manager or the owner will step in and say this doesn't look like it's going the way it supposed to. How can I help. But that is absolutely not what happened! No it seems that the manager and the owner were too busy, telling her how to get her to sell products. And when I declined the treatment that have been used on my hair the first time because I didn't like the results she came back with well I'm going to send you home with some thing. I thought pool free sample... No as a matter fact after I checked out and left I received a text asking if I could be charged $45 for the product I did not want and then was charged 50. I had a meeting with someone called Ashley, who I cannot believe is actually a business owner because she is the most unprofessional, vile, disgusting, rude, disrespectful, and hateful person I have ever had the displeasure of meeting! The only thing she said at that meeting that made sense was well. The pictures don't lie... despite the fact that she could clearly see I had not gotten what I paid for. She said there was nothing she would do. She said she ran $1 million company and I was wasting her time. So yes, I filed a complaint with state board, the Better Business Bureau and I will see them in court !

    As someone with thin, baby fine hair that grows very slowly, it's always daunting to find a new…read morehairstylist when we move to a new city. Many times the stylist doesn't actually listen to me that I can't really do layers, I pretty much need a blunt cut. And then it will take nearly a year to grow out the bad cut. Not so with Brenda! She also has slightly fine, thin hair so she can relate completely. Not only did she listen to my needs for my haircut, she even recommended leaving just a bit more length than I was initially thinking. I like the resulting look, and if I hadn't, I appreciate erring on the side of caution, since it's much easier to cut more than to slowly grow out. She also had tips for where to part my hair and styling tips to help prevent breakage. Brenda was also nice enough to work me in for a same day appointment on very short notice. I'm so relieved to find a good, reliable stylist for Williamsburg!
